About The Role

We're seeking an exceptional Lead Product Manager to lead our squad focused on delighting decision makers. In this role you will shape the future of how enterprise users interact with AI-powered decision intelligence across their organisation. You'll be at the forefront of Faculty Frontier TM - our ambitious vision to create the first enterprise-grade platform that unifies decision intelligence with AI Agents. You will work on highly complex and consequential problems across the real economy, with particular focus on healthcare and life sciences.

This is a unique opportunity to work at the cutting edge of AI, owning both our AI Agent capabilities and the Decision Hub - the primary interface through which decision makers use Frontier. You'll translate breakthrough capabilities in agent orchestration, simulation, and optimisation into products that revolutionise how Fortune 500 companies make their most critical decisions.
